> SET NEVER "Jan 1 2010" > SET X1_DATE [NEVER] > RHE I get a "parse error" on the second line. If I change the pair > to > 1) Any idea why this would be different. It was a change in Remind (3.1.9, I think). The correct syntax has always been "set var expr", but older versions of Remind would tolerate "set var [expr]". No more!
